ABSTRACT: The Ac conductivity of the system Te80S20-xAsx was very small under the effect of each of frequency and temperature. The exponent factor decrease with temperature and reach zero at high temperature. The zero value of the exponent factor keep the electric conduction at minimum constant value. The dielectric constant and dielectric losses very high at low frequency and their values depends the medium temperature. At high frequency, the dielectric constant and dielectric losses become temperature independent. The addition of As on expense of S decrease the Ac conductivity and increase dielectric properties. The low Ac conductivity and high dielectric properties confirm the use of these material as optic fiber cables.
